FG extends airport shutdown by two weeks as UK evacuates 213
The Federal Government yesterday extended the shutdown of airports nationwide by another two weeks.
The Minister of Aviation, Hadi Sirika, who disclosed this via his Twitter account, stated that the facilities would no longer open for commercial operations on April 23.
Besides, the British Airways flight, BA9157, has evacuated 213 United Kingdom citizens from the Murtala Muhammed International Airport (MMIA), Lagos.
The Boeing 747 aircraft with registration number G-CIVO with 22 crewmembers landed the airport at 1.22 pm. The plane thereafter departed at 4pm with 235 persons on board.
